A new park designed for human and canine recreation opened today in western Bangkok.
Located on Soi Phetkasem 69, the Bang Khae Phirom Park’s 119 rai (19 hectares) of land includes exercise and recreation facilities, a jogging track, bicycle lane, exercise spaces and workout equipment in addition to an area set aside for the frolicking of dogs, according to City Hall.
The dog section includes a 300-meter dog path and stations for them to drink water.
An additional area is under construction that will include a flea market expected to open in March.
The park is open 5am to 9pm daily. Access it via Soi Ban Khlong Khwang (see map below).
